Szczegóły projektu
Prezentacja realizacji projektu w ramach kwalifikacji INF.03
Teoria baz danych – Tabela wymagań
Nr | Temat | Wymagania podstawowe | Wymagania rozszerzone | Wymagania dopełniające | Wymagania wykraczające |
---|---|---|---|---|---|
1 | Podstawowe pojęcia baz danych | Definiuje pojęcia bazy danych i SZBD, wymienia ich cechy i przykłady | Charakteryzuje bazy danych i SZBD, opisuje ich cechy | Porównuje bazę lokalną i sieciową, wyszukuje wersje SZBD | Dobiera optymalną platformę sprzętową dla SZBD |
2 | Modele baz danych | Wymienia modele baz danych | Charakteryzuje modele baz danych | Porównuje modele, podaje przykłady zastosowania | Dobiera model odpowiedni do rodzaju danych |
3 | Relacyjne bazy danych | Definiuje relacyjną bazę, krotkę, atrybut, encję; zna zasady budowy tabel | Charakteryzuje relacyjne bazy, opisuje ich składniki | Identyfikuje elementy w tabeli i ich poprawność | Dobiera nazwy tabel i atrybutów |
4 | Pojęcie klucza i rodzaje kluczy | Definiuje klucz i jego rodzaje | Opisuje klucze proste, złożone, sztuczne, obce | Identyfikuje klucze w tabelach | Dobiera klucz główny i kandydujące |
5 | Normalizacja relacyjnej bazy danych | Definiuje relację i normalizację, wymienia postacie normalne | Charakteryzuje typy relacji i proces normalizacji | Określa relacje między tabelami, klucze główne i obce | Weryfikuje spełnienie warunków postaci normalnych |
6 | Przykłady normalizacji | Wymienia cechy 1NF, 2NF, 3NF | Charakteryzuje bazy w 1NF, 2NF, 3NF | Normalizuje tabele do 1NF, 2NF, 3NF | Podaje przykłady błędów w nieznormalizowanych bazach |